About Providence
Providence, one of the US’s largest not-for-profit healthcare systems, is committed to high quality, compassionate healthcare for all. Driven by the belief that health is a human right and the vision, ‘Health for a better world’, Providence and its 121,000 caregivers strive to provide everyone access to affordable quality care and services.
Providence has a network of 51 hospitals, 1,000+ care clinics, senior services, supportive housing, and other health and educational services in the US.
Providence India is bringing to fruition the transformational shift of the healthcare ecosystem to Health 2.0. The India center will have focused efforts around healthcare technology and innovation, and play a vital role in driving digital transformation of health systems for improved patient outcomes and experiences, caregiver efficiency, and running the business of Providence at scale.

- Develop and maintain Salesforce applications using Apex, Lightning Web Components (LWC), Visualforce, and other Salesforce development tools.
- Implement and manage Salesforce configurations, including flows, validation rules, email templates, roles, sharing rules, and security settings.
- Customize Salesforce applications to meet business needs and enhance user experience.
- Work under the guidance of senior Salesforce developers and architects to deliver solutions aligned with technical designs.
- Collaborate with team members and stakeholders to gather requirements and clarify business needs.
- Assist in testing and debugging to ensure the quality and reliability of Salesforce solutions.
- Support API integrations to connect Salesforce with other systems.
- Assist in deployment processes, including version control, release management, and sandbox testing.
- Prepare technical documentation for Salesforce customizations and configurations.
- Monitor and resolve issues related to Salesforce applications, ensuring minimal downtime.
- 3+ years of experience in Salesforce development and configuration.
- Hands-on experience with Apex, Triggers, Lightning Web Components (LWC), and Salesforce declarative tools.
- Basic knowledge of Salesforce API integrations (REST/SOAP).
- Proficiency in Salesforce configuration: flows, email integrations, roles, sharing rules, and security models.
- Proven experience working with Service Cloud.
- Experience in deployment processes.
- Strong problem-solving and debugging skills.
- Ability to work collaboratively in a team environment.
- Good communication skills for interacting with team members and stakeholders.
- Salesforce certifications such as Salesforce Administrator or Platform Developer I are preferred.
- Knowledge of DevOps tools like Git, Jenkins, and CI/CD pipelines is a plus.
- Familiarity with Agile/Scrum methodologies are highly desirable.
